Avanti West Coast

About
Avanti West Coast is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ates high-speed trains between London and major cities in the UK, including Birmingham, Manchester, Liverpool, Glasgow and Edinburgh. The company offers a range of ticket types, including Standard, First Class and Advance t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, comfortable seating and a range of food and drinks. The most popular routes for Avanti West Coast are London to Birmingham, London to Manchester and London to Glasgow. The company operates a fleet of Pendolino and Super Voyager trains, which offer a smooth and comfortable journey.

Complete guide to Leicester

Things to do in Leicester

Discover the best of Leicester — top attractions, local food, transport tips, budget advice, and currency essentials. Plan your perfect Leicester trip today.

  • Must visit

Leicester Museum & Art Gallery

Leicester's flagship museum and gallery, known for dinosaurs, German Expressionism and broad collections for first-time visitors.

  • Must visit

King Richard III Visitor Centre

Dedicated to the 2012 discovery of Richard III, this award-winning museum uses immersive displays to tell a remarkable royal story.

  • Recommended

Abbey Pumping Station

A grand Victorian pumping station with working steam heritage displays, making industrial history surprisingly engaging for all ages.

British pound sterling (£)

Moderate for the UK. Hotels and dining are usually cheaper than London, while buses and casual meals stay fairly affordable for most visitors.

Average meal costs

Budget
£8-12 for fast food or a simple meal.
Mid-range
£18-30 per person for a restaurant meal.
Fine dining
£50+ per person for upscale dining.
Coffee
£2.50-4 for a cappuccino.

Tipping culture

Tipping is optional. In restaurants, 10-12.5% is common if service is not included. Round up for taxis. Cafe tipping is not expected, but small change is appreciated.

In Leicester, travelers should be cautious of pickpocketing, especially in crowded areas like markets and public transport. Common scams include overcharging by taxi drivers who are not licensed and street vendors selling counterfeit goods. Staying vigilant in busy spots and using licensed services helps ensure a safer visit.
